Clavier entrée sortie - récuperer un string entier
Salut,
Je cherche un moyen de récupérer l’intégralité du contenu d'un textfield. En effet, j'utilise l’événement onKeyPressed en FXML et j'utilise un KeyEvent pour récupérer le String correspondant qui n'est qu'un caractère compte tenu de l’événement.
Je n'arrive pas à voir quel événement je dois utiliser ou si il y a autre chose à faire.
Par exemple :
Java (contrôleur) :
Code:
1 2 3 4 5 6 7 8
| @FXML
void GetCondQte (KeyEvent evt){
if(!(evt.getCode() == KeyCode.ENTER)) {
this.CondQte = Integer.parseInt(evt.getText());
((TextField)evt.getSource()).clear();
System.out.println("Pressed");
}
} |
FXML :
Code:
<TextField onKeyPressed="#GetCondQte" layoutX="166.0" layoutY="188.0" prefHeight="25.0" prefWidth="44.0" />